Speller Metcalfe Ltd in Malvern is seeking a Design Manager to oversee preconstruction and construction phase design deliverables. The successful candidate will manage multiple projects, ensuring compliance with regulations and leading the design team effectively.
The ideal candidate should have 10–15 years of relevant experience and a strong track record in delivering projects, particularly in sectors like commercial or healthcare.
Additionally, competitive salary and benefits such as increasing holiday time and private healthcare will be provided.
